private void FindPartiesBtn_Click(object sender, EventArgs e)
        {
            PartiesDataGridView.Rows.Clear();
            var list = _service.GetAllJoinedParties(_dataStorage.UserId);

            foreach (var aux in list)
            {
                var partyTable = new WCFService.PartyTable
                {
                    ID                = aux.ID,
                    ownerID           = aux.ownerID,
                    startDate         = aux.startDate,
                    endDate           = aux.endDate,
                    locationLatitude  = aux.locationLatitude,
                    locationLongitude = aux.locationLongitude,
                    Name              = aux.Name,
                    privacy           = aux.privacy
                };

                var index = PartiesDataGridView.Rows.Add();
                var row   = PartiesDataGridView.Rows[index];

                row.Cells["ID"].Value                = partyTable.ID;
                row.Cells["ownerID"].Value           = partyTable.ownerID;
                row.Cells["startDate"].Value         = partyTable.startDate;
                row.Cells["endDate"].Value           = partyTable.endDate;
                row.Cells["locationLatitude"].Value  = partyTable.locationLatitude;
                row.Cells["locationLongitude"].Value = partyTable.locationLongitude;
                row.Cells["PartyName"].Value         = partyTable.Name;
                row.Cells["privacy"].Value           = partyTable.privacy;
            }
        }
Exemplo n.º 2
0
        private void CreateBtn_Click(object sender, EventArgs e)
        {
            short aPlaces = 0;

            if (LimitBox.Text != string.Empty)
            {
                aPlaces = short.Parse(LimitBox.Text);
            }

            var party = new WCFService.PartyTable
            {
                ownerID           = _dataStorage.UserId,
                startDate         = StartDateTimePicker.Value.Date.AddHours(StartTimePicker.Value.Hour).AddMinutes(StartTimePicker.Value.Minute),
                endDate           = EndDateTimePicker.Value.Date.AddHours(EndTimePicker.Value.Hour).AddMinutes(EndTimePicker.Value.Minute),
                locationLatitude  = 0,
                locationLongitude = 0,
                privacy           = YesCheckBox.Checked,
                Name            = NameTxt.Text,
                AvailablePlaces = aPlaces
            };

            _dataStorage.CurrentSelectedPartyId = _service.CreateParty(party);

            BackBtn_Click(sender, e);
        }
Exemplo n.º 3
0
        protected void CreateBtn_Click(object sender, EventArgs e)
        {
            var party = new WCFService.PartyTable
            {
                ownerID           = Convert.ToInt32(Session["id"]),
                startDate         = StartDateCalendar.SelectedDate,
                endDate           = EndDateCalendar.SelectedDate,
                locationLatitude  = 0,
                locationLongitude = 0,
                privacy           = CheckBox.Checked,
                Name = NameTxt.Text
            };

            _service.CreateParty(party);

            Response.Redirect("MainMenu.aspx");
        }
        private void UpdateBtn_Click(object sender, EventArgs e)
        {
            var party = new WCFService.PartyTable
            {
                ID                = _dataStorage.CurrentSelectedPartyId,
                ownerID           = _dataStorage.UserId,
                startDate         = StartDateTimePicker.Value.Date.AddHours(StartTimePicker.Value.Hour).AddMinutes(StartTimePicker.Value.Minute),
                endDate           = EndDateTimePicker.Value.Date.AddHours(EndTimePicker.Value.Hour).AddMinutes(EndTimePicker.Value.Minute),
                locationLatitude  = 0,
                locationLongitude = 0,
                privacy           = YesCheckBox.Checked,
                Name              = NameTxt.Text,
                AvailablePlaces   = short.Parse(LimitBox.Text),
                RowVersion        = currentRowVersion
            };

            _service.UpdateParty(party);

            BackBtn_Click(sender, e);
        }